The Greatest Common Divisor of 38 and 15 is as follows:
1
To find the Greatest Common Divisor of 38 and 15, we first list all the divisors of 38
and all the divisors of 15. Then, we compare the two lists of divisors and pick the largest (greatest)
number that is on both lists, which will be the Greatest Common Divisor of 38 and 15.
Here is the list of 38 divisors: 1, 2, 19, 38
And here is the list of 15 divisors: 1, 3, 5, 15
When we compare the two lists, we see that the greatest number they have in common is 1.
Therefore, once again, the answer to the question "What is the Greatest Common Divisor of 38 and 15?" is:
1
Note, the divisors of 38 are all the numbers you can divide into 38 with no remainder, and the divisors of 15 are
all the numbers you can divide into 15 with no remainder.
